Numerous sorts of medicines can aid deal with anxiousness, and you and your medical professional might need to attempt several medications to locate the ideal medicine and dose with very little adverse effects. The pharmacologic therapy of anxiousness conditions generally includes antidepressants, anti-anxiety medications, beta-blockers, or benzodiazepines, with each having its mechanism of action and effects on anxiousness.
Instances of benzodiazepines consist of lorazepam (Ativan), diazepam (Valium), and clonazepam (Valium). Buspirone is utilized to treat both short-term and long-term anxiousness by modifying chemicals in the brain that control mood.
Some types of therapy teach techniques that assist you change purposeless thought patterns and change your habits. Cognitive actions therapy and other behavioral therapies are leading evidence-based emotional treatments for anxiousness, focusing on structured methods to sign reduction.
Cognitive-behavioral treatment (CBT) is highly reliable in the therapy of stress and anxiety. During CBT therapy, your psycho therapist will aid you learn different means to identify and take care of the elements that contribute to your anxiousness.
In a recent study of the lasting outcomes of CBT and psychodynamic treatment, social anxiety patients reported remission prices of 40% for both kinds of treatment, showing that both CBT and psychoanalysis take treatments for stress and anxiety problems and other psychiatric problems. Social treatment (IPT) is a kind of psychiatric therapy generally used in the therapy of depression and anxiousness disorders.
With the help of your therapist, you'll discover healthy and balanced means to share emotions and connect with others. Acceptance and commitment therapy (ACT) is likewise an efficient treatment for anxiety and related disorders. During ACT, you'll find out different ways to recognize your life worths and act according to those values. ACT is based on the idea that excruciating thoughts and feelings become part of the human condition.
In an additional study, a mix of dedication therapy and cognitive therapy was revealed to be reliable in treating anxiety and depression people in professional practice. It's normal to feel anxious in some cases. It's exactly how we react to really feeling endangered, under pressure or stressed out: as an example, if we have a test, work meeting or doctor's visit. Anxiousness isn't always a bad thing. It can stimulate us on, assist us stay sharp, make us knowledgeable about dangers and encourage us to resolve problems.
If your anxiousness is recurring, intense, tough to control or out of proportion to your scenario, it can be an indicator of a psychological illness. While preventing situations can provide you short-term alleviation, the anxiety commonly returns the next time you remain in the situation. Preventing it only reinforces the sensation of threat and never provides you an opportunity to figure out whether your fears hold true or otherwise. Anxiousness UK was developed in 1970 and is run by and for those with stress and anxiety, supplying a substantial series of support solutions created to help sustain those impacted by stress and anxiety conditions, anxiousness and anxiety-based anxiety.
Anxiety UK additionally use fast access to a range of psychological treatment services, consisting of counselling, Cognitive Behavioural Treatment (CBT), Concern Focused Therapy (CFT), clinical hypnotherapy and Eye Motion Desensitisation and Reprocessing (EMDR) treatment, with appointments readily available in person, online and by telephone.

Generalized Anxiousness Disorder (GAD) GAD includes excessive and persistent fretting about different elements of life, such as health, work, or partnerships. This concern is typically out of proportion to the actual circumstance and can be debilitating, affecting one's capability to operate generally on a day-to-day basis.
